Released in 2015, Lightroom 6 was the final version of the software available for a one-time purchase. Adobe officially discontinued support, security updates, and camera compatibility patches for Lightroom 6 at the end of 2017. The Downside of Using Discontinued Legacy Software:

For users experiencing lag, particularly when panning at 100% zoom, a common fix was to ensure the software was set to use the "High Performance" GPU setting in the NVIDIA control panel. Alternatively, if the GPU caused instability, disabling the "Use Graphics Processor" option in Lightroom's Performance preferences could resolve issues.
